Real estate companies rely on a steady stream of leads to keep their businesses thriving. In today’s highly competitive market, generating and nurturing leads has become an increasingly complex process. As a result, many real estate companies are turning to lead intelligence as a way to gain an edge over their competitors.
Lead intelligence is the process of gathering and analyzing data about potential customers to better understand their needs, preferences, and behavior. This data can be used to inform a wide range of business decisions, from marketing strategies to sales tactics.
Here are some key reasons why lead intelligence is so important for real estate companies:
With so many potential leads out there, it can be challenging to know where to focus your efforts. Lead intelligence can help you to identify and target the right prospects for your business. By gathering data on factors such as age, income, location, and interests, you can hone your sales messaging and follow-ups as well as create targeted marketing campaigns that are more likely to convert. This can save you time and money, and increase your chances of closing more deals.
Once you’re armed with key details about your prospective homebuyers, lead intelligence can help you to create personalized marketing messages that resonate with them. Maybe you have a strong segment of boomer leads looking to downsize as they prepare for retirement. Perhaps a large portion of prospects say they want to relocate to a warmer climate. You may even have knowledge of their buying timeline and budget. By analyzing your leads’ behavior and preferences, you can create content and messages that address their specific needs and pain points. This can help to build trust and establish a relationship with your leads, which can ultimately result in more conversions.
Not all leads are ready to buy right away. Many will require some nurturing before they are ready to make a purchase. This is especially true for lifestyle community homebuyers, whose average sales cycle is around 18 months. In fact, recent PCR research shows that over 70% of prospects looking for a home in a lifestyle community have a purchase timeline of between 1-2 years. Lead intelligence can help you to understand where your leads are in the buying process and create targeted content and messages to move them further down the sales funnel. By providing value and building trust over time, you can increase your chances of closing more deals.
Effective communication is key to converting prospects into buyers. With lead intelligence, you can better understand your leads’ preferred communication channels and styles. This can help you to tailor your messages to their needs and preferences and use the right channels to reach them. For example, if you know that a potential customer prefers to communicate via email, you can send them targeted emails with relevant content that addresses their specific needs.
Finally, lead intelligence can help real estate companies to stay ahead of the competition. By analyzing market trends and customer behavior, you can identify opportunities and make more informed business decisions. For example, if you notice that a certain type of property is in high demand, you can adjust your marketing strategy to focus on that type of property. In the case of PCR users who come searching for a lifestyle, knowing the states and regions they are relocating to as well as the preferred amenities they seek in prospective communities allows you to target the right prospect to close deals faster. This can help you to differentiate your community from your competitors and attract not just more leads—but better leads.
